Solution Overview
Problem
Existing web services platforms delay data presentation by storing raw timeseries data in relational databases without significant organization or processing, leading to inefficient data retrieval and delayed presentation in building management systems.
Innovation Solution
A method for configuring and commissioning a building automation system by selecting compute resources based on processing power requirements, generating deployable software images, and optimizing data processing to enhance responsiveness and fault detection in building management systems.

If raw timeseries data is stored in a relational database without significant organization or processing, then data storage is simplified, but data retrieval and presentation are delayed
Solution Approach 1:
The patent pre-processes and organizes timeseries data into structured formats (e.g., time buckets, aggregated statistics) at the time of data ingestion rather than waiting until query time. This preliminary organization enables faster retrieval and presentation when applications request data, resolving the contradiction between storage simplicity and presentation speed.

If compute resources are allocated to perform calculations and communications in a distributed building automation system, then system functionality is enhanced, but resource allocation complexity increases
Solution Approach 1:
The patent implements self-service mechanisms where compute resources automatically assess their own capacity and make decisions about task allocation and execution. Each compute resource can independently determine whether to perform calculations or communicate based on its current load and capabilities, reducing the need for complex centralized resource management while maintaining enhanced system functionality.

AI summary
Systems and methods are disclosed that create a deployment package for commissioning of a building control system. The deployment package may include a series of automated validation sequences that ensure each equipment and/or device is properly configured and installed. A validation sequence is performed, and the behavior is compared to expected behavior for the sequence. A brokering architecture facilitates the commissioning by providing a fixed schema to all applications communicating over the message bus, thus standardizing the deployment package and the validation sequences. Correlations between data may be found and used when data is missing in the same or similar equipment.
